For $r\\in \\mathbb{N}$, the $r$-independence number of $G$, denoted $\\alpha_r(G)$, is the largest size of a $K_r$-free set of vertices in $G$. In this paper, we discuss Ramsey--Tur\\'an-type theorems for tilings where one is interested in minimum degree and independence number conditions (and the interaction between the two) that guarantee the existence of optimal $F$-tilings.
